Plymouth Voyager owners have reported 30 child seat related problems since 1996. Table 1 shows the 4 most common child seat problems. The number one most common problem is related to the vehicle's child seat (18 problems). The second most common problem is related to the vehicle's child seat tether strap (6 problems). The car seat came with the vehicle and harness latch opened and closed intermittently. The consumers daughter was buckled into the built in car seat, and when it was time to get her out, the seat belt wouldn't extend out to release. The straps remained locked and will not release. The intergrated child saftey system setbelt locked, not allowing the belt to be pulled away from child. No accident occurred to cause the belt to lock. After the child was removed, by releasing the anchor clip, the belt began to function normally. Read details...
My four year old child can pull the shoulder harness clip apart without disengaging (squeezing) the clip compenents together. Both harness clips on the 2 integrated child seats(front bench) can be pulled apart. Both clips were replaced by dealership on 8/2/02, yet continue to be defective. Read details...
